Output 597852a63b0108cd33becb970309c316bcfe732c54b131b4f0fb74e3614143b2:24

value
4800000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 425b9ed96292b4da684f3ac8661fc9dbad018483 OP_EQUALVERIFY OP_CHECKSIG
address
173sMZmsrGoDLh5U8edXZFC5eftJXVESvC
transaction
597852a63b0108cd33becb970309c316bcfe732c54b131b4f0fb74e3614143b2
spent
true